How they compare

Qatar currently reports 1,246 against 1,144 in Armenia, a difference of 102.

That makes Qatar's figure about 1.1 times Armenia's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 19 shared years of data; in 2010 it was Armenia ahead.

Armenia ranks 124th and Qatar ranks 122nd of 166 countries.

Across the 10 decades both report, Armenia averaged higher in 8 and Qatar in 2.

Total population in thousands that has completed upper secondary or incomplete post-secondary education as the highest level of educational attainment. Projections are based on collected census and survey data for the base year (around 2010) and the Medium Shared Socioeconomic Pathways (SSP2) projection model. The SSP2 is a middle-of-the-road scenario that combines medium fertility with medium mortality, medium migration, and the Global Education Trend (GET) education scenario.
